Output 8c572d70bcc41a5256dc659431f7429e4d4c7b4fc0f63113eb48c2f9687c427a:1

value
13464714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d88241576513767e73059db31dae3b2a3917563 OP_EQUAL
address
3MtNMBFKVJUCgTxpZuBu4BAk8d49i5D7uG
transaction
8c572d70bcc41a5256dc659431f7429e4d4c7b4fc0f63113eb48c2f9687c427a
spent
true